The Texas Veterinary Medical Foundation offers a special donation to honor veterinarians who have provided outstanding health care to their patients. The Veterinary Honor Roll offers a unique opportunity to both honor your veterinarian and give a gift that will resonate for years to come.
For a minimum donation of $10, we will send your honored veterinarian a card of acknowledgment so that they are aware of your generous contribution and be acknowledged on our website.
Donations made to Honor Your Veterinarian help fund the emergency student grant fund, stethoscopes for new veterinary students and scholarships.
